The Department of Health Tennessee is taking a crucial initiative to provide quality healthcare services to rural communities with limited access to medical facilities. With the implementation of new telehealth services, rural residents can now receive medical consultations and treatments without having to travel long distances. This innovative approach is not only enhancing healthcare access but is also expected to improve health outcomes for those living in remote areas.

Telehealth services have been around for a while, but they have recently gained more significance, given the global pandemic. With the COVID-19 outbreak, physical distancing has become a norm, and technology has become imperative in connecting patients with medical professionals. Telehealth services, such as video consultations and virtual medical appointments, have emerged as a crucial tool in providing healthcare services to patients in remote areas, where access to healthcare was a problem.

The Tennessee Health Department’s latest effort is explicitly targeted towards rural residents who have limited access to physical health services due to their location. This initiative aims to provide secure and interactive telehealth services that are accessible from remote locations. Rural residents will have access to consultations with licensed medical professionals for a wide range of healthcare needs, including primary care, behavioral health, and dermatology services, among others.

It is estimated that approximately one in five Tennesseans live in rural areas, and these residents face significant challenges when accessing healthcare services. Rural areas typically have fewer medical facilities, and the distance between the patient’s home and the nearest medical facility can be a significant barrier to access health care. Telehealth services come as a critical intervention to eliminate this barrier and enable patients to access healthcare services without having to travel long distances.
